Blog

Microsoft Access vs SQL Server: Quel est le meilleur carburant du générateur en 2023?

Lorsqu'il s'agit de choisir le bon système de base de données pour votre entreprise, cela peut être une tâche intimidante. Deux des bases de données les plus populaires sont Microsoft Access et SQL Server, et chacune d'elles a leurs propres fonctionnalités et avantages uniques. Dans cet article, nous comparerons et contrasterons Microsoft Access et SQL Server pour vous aider à prendre une décision éclairée sur laquelle est la meilleure pour les besoins de votre entreprise.

Accès Microsoft Serveur SQL
Microsoft Access est un système de gestion de base de données (DBMS) de Microsoft qui combine le moteur de base de données Microsoft Jet relationnel avec une interface utilisateur graphique et des outils de développement logiciel. SQL Server est un système de gestion de base de données relationnel développé par Microsoft. Il s'agit d'une base de données complète principalement conçue pour rivaliser avec les concurrents Oracle Database (DB) et MySQL.
Il est mieux utilisé pour les utilisateurs uniques et les groupes de travail plus petits qui ont besoin de créer rapidement des applications de base de données de bureau ou basées sur le Web. Il est mieux utilisé pour les applications au niveau de l'entreprise, les grandes applications Web et les entrepôts de données.
Il est disponible pour Windows, Mac OS et iOS. Il est disponible pour Windows et Linux.
Microsoft Access est moins cher. SQL Server est plus puissant et offre plus de fonctionnalités.

Microsoft Access vs SQL Server

Microsoft Access vs SQL Server: Tableau de comparaison

Accès Microsoft Serveur SQL
Type de base de données Système de gestion des bases de données relationnelles (RDBM) Système de gestion des bases de données relationnelles (RDBM)
Stockage de données Base de données d'accès (MDB ou ACCDB) Base de données SQL Server (MDF)
Sécurité des données Protégé par mot de passe et crypté Contrôle d'authentification et d'accès des utilisateurs
Concurrence des données Aucun contrôle de concurrence Niveau d'isolement de verrouillage et de transaction au niveau des lignes
Intégrité des données Clés primaires et étrangères Clés primaires et étrangères, contraintes de chèque et par défaut
Manipulation de données Lent et limité Rapide et puissant
Objets de base de données Tables, requêtes, formulaires, rapports, macros et modules Tableaux, vues, procédures stockées, déclencheurs et fonctions
Évolutivité Limité Haut
Plate-forme Fenêtre Windows & Linux
Coût Faible Haut

Microsoft Access vs SQL Server

Microsoft Access et SQL Server sont les deux bases de données relationnelles les plus populaires sur le marché. Les deux offrent une gamme de fonctionnalités conçues pour aider les utilisateurs à stocker, à gérer et à récupérer des données, mais il existe des différences clés entre les deux. Cet article comparera les fonctionnalités de chaque base de données et discutera des avantages et des inconvénients de chacun.

Capacité et performance

Microsoft Access est conçu pour les petits groupes d'utilisateurs et les utilisateurs individuels, il a donc une capacité maximale de 2 Go par fichier de base de données. Il est également limité à un seul processeur et à deux utilisateurs simultanés. D'un autre côté, SQL Server est conçu pour des groupes d'utilisateurs plus importants et n'a aucune limite sur le nombre d'utilisateurs ou la quantité de données qui peuvent être stockées. Il est également conçu pour gérer plusieurs processeurs et peut prendre en charge des milliers d'utilisateurs. En termes de performances, SQL Server est généralement plus rapide que l'accès, car il est conçu pour gérer des requêtes plus complexes et de grandes quantités de données.

Fonctionnalité

Microsoft Access est conçu pour être convivial et facile à utiliser, il est donc idéal pour les applications à petite échelle et les groupes d'utilisateurs. Il comprend également des fonctionnalités telles que des formulaires et des rapports, et permet la création d'applications personnalisées. SQL Server, en revanche, a des fonctionnalités et des capacités plus avancées, telles que la possibilité de créer des procédures et des déclencheurs stockés. Il est également plus puissant en ce qui concerne l'exploration de données et l'entreposage de données.

Coût

L'accès à Microsoft est généralement considéré comme l'option la plus rentable pour les petits groupes d'utilisateurs. Il est disponible dans le cadre de la suite Microsoft Office, qui est beaucoup moins chère que la version complète de SQL Server. Cependant, le coût de SQL Server peut être justifié par sa plus grande évolutivité, performances et fonctionnalités.

Sécurité

Microsoft Access fournit des fonctionnalités de sécurité de base, telles que l'authentification des utilisateurs et le chiffrement des données. Cependant, il n'est pas aussi sécurisé que SQL Server, qui offre des fonctionnalités de sécurité plus avancées telles que la sécurité basée sur les rôles, le chiffrement et les pare-feu.

Soutien

Microsoft Access est pris en charge par Microsoft, afin que les utilisateurs puissent accéder à une large gamme de ressources et d'options de support. SQL Server est également pris en charge par Microsoft, mais il oblige souvent les utilisateurs à acheter des services d'assistance supplémentaires.

partie

Microsoft Access vs SQL Server

Pros

  • Microsoft Access est plus facile à utiliser que SQL Server.
  • Microsoft Access est moins cher que SQL Server.
  • Microsoft Access peut être utilisé pour une variété de tâches, de la création de formulaires et de rapports à l'exécution de requêtes.

Inconvénients

  • Microsoft Access n'est pas aussi puissant que SQL Server.
  • Microsoft Access n'a pas la même évolutivité que SQL Server.
  • Microsoft Access n'est pas aussi sécurisé que SQL Server.

Microsoft Access vs SQL Server: Quel est le meilleur?

En conclusion, Microsoft Access et SQL Server sont de puissants systèmes de gestion de base de données. Microsoft Access convient aux petites et moyennes entreprises, tandis que SQL Server convient aux entreprises à grande échelle. Les deux ont leurs forces et leurs faiblesses, mais en ce qui concerne l'évolutivité, la sécurité des données et les performances, SQL Server est le gagnant clair. Microsoft Access est plus intuitif et convivial, et il a une interface utilisateur graphique qui simplifie de nombreux processus dans la création et la gestion de la base de données. SQL Server est plus complexe et nécessite des connaissances plus techniques, mais elle offre un niveau d'évolutivité, de sécurité et de performances plus élevés. En fin de compte, il appartient à l'utilisateur de décider quel est le meilleur choix pour ses besoins.

Questions fréquemment posées: Microsoft Access vs SQL Server

Quelle est la différence entre Microsoft Access et SQL Server?

Microsoft Access est un système de gestion de base de données relationnel (RDBM) de Microsoft qui combine le moteur de base de données Microsoft Jet relationnel avec une interface utilisateur graphique et des outils de développement logiciel. Il est membre de la suite de candidatures Microsoft Office, incluse dans les éditions professionnelles et supérieures ou vendues séparément. SQL Server est un système de gestion de base de données relationnel (RDBM) développé par Microsoft. Il s'agit d'une base de données complète principalement conçue pour concurrencer la base de données Oracle et d'autres SGBDR. Il est utilisé pour stocker et gérer de grandes quantités de données et pour fournir un accès aux données rapidement et facilement.

La principale différence entre Microsoft Access et SQL Server est que Microsoft Access est idéal pour créer des bases de données plus petites tandis que SQL Server est meilleur pour les bases de données plus grandes. Microsoft Access est plus facile à utiliser et est plus adapté pour créer des bases de données qui ne sont pas trop complexes et nécessitent peu de maintenance. SQL Server est plus puissant et offre une meilleure évolutivité, permettant plus de données et plusieurs utilisateurs.

Quel est le coût de Microsoft Access et SQL Server?

Microsoft Access est généralement inclus avec l'achat de Microsoft Office et peut également être acheté séparément pour environ 150-200 $. SQL Server est disponible dans différentes éditions, avec des prix allant de 1 000 $ à 14 000 $ selon l'édition et les fonctionnalités.

Lequel est le meilleur pour les grandes bases de données?

SQL Server est meilleur pour les grandes bases de données car elle offre une meilleure évolutivité et peut gérer plus de données et plusieurs utilisateurs. L'accès à Microsoft est mieux adapté aux petites bases de données qui ne sont pas trop complexes et nécessitent peu de maintenance.

Comment accéder aux bases de données créées dans Microsoft Access et SQL Server?

Les bases de données Microsoft Access sont accessibles avec Microsoft Access ou d'autres programmes tels que OpenOffice. Les bases de données SQL Server sont accessibles au Microsoft SQL Server Management Studio ou à d'autres programmes tels que MySQL Workbench.

Quel type de données peut être stocké dans Microsoft Access et SQL Server?

Microsoft Access peut stocker des données dans divers formats, y compris le texte, le numéro, la devise, la date / l'heure et oui / non. SQL Server peut stocker des données dans divers formats, notamment des données BLOB, binaire, texte, numérique, date / heure et spatiale.

Quelles fonctionnalités de sécurité sont disponibles pour Microsoft Access et SQL Server?

Microsoft Access fournit des fonctionnalités telles que la sécurité au niveau de l'utilisateur, le chiffrement et la validation des données. SQL Server fournit des fonctionnalités de sécurité avancées telles que l'audit, le chiffrement, la sécurité au niveau des lignes et le chiffrement des données transparentes.

Quels sont les avantages de l'utilisation de Microsoft Access et SQL Server?

Microsoft Access est facile à utiliser et est mieux adapté pour créer des bases de données plus petites qui nécessitent peu de maintenance. Il fournit également des fonctionnalités telles que la sécurité au niveau de l'utilisateur, le chiffrement et la validation des données. SQL Server est plus puissant et offre une meilleure évolutivité, permettant plus de données et plusieurs utilisateurs. Il fournit également des fonctionnalités de sécurité avancées telles que l'audit, le chiffrement, la sécurité au niveau des lignes et le chiffrement transparent des données.

Microsoft Access et SQL Server ont tous deux leurs avantages et leurs inconvénients pour différents types de gestion des données. Microsoft Access est un excellent choix pour les particuliers et les petites entreprises qui ont besoin d'un moyen simple et rentable de stocker et de gérer les données. D'un autre côté, SQL Server est idéal pour les grandes entreprises et les organisations qui nécessitent un niveau élevé de sécurité, d'évolutivité et de performances des données. En fin de compte, la décision de la base de données à utiliser se résume aux besoins individuels et au budget de l'organisation. Quelle que soit l'option que vous choisissez, vous pouvez être assuré que vous prenez une décision judicieuse pour vos besoins de gestion des données.